Introduction

Understanding police codes can be crucial for both law enforcement officers and the general public. One such code is '10-54,' which signifies a situation involving a deceased individual. This code is part of the larger set of ten-codes, often used in radio communication to ensure clarity and brevity. Knowing these codes can help in understanding police reports, news broadcasts, and public safety announcements.

Here are some important points regarding the '10-54' police code:
  • Contextual Use: The '10-54' code is utilized primarily in situations where law enforcement is responding to a report of a deceased person.
  • Importance of Codes: Police codes like '10-54' help streamline communication, allowing officers to convey critical information quickly.
  • Public Awareness: Being aware of such codes can aid community members in understanding police activity in their area.
  • Variability: It's important to note that police codes can vary by region, so '10-54' may not have the same meaning everywhere.

FAQs

What does the police code '10-54' mean?

The '10-54' police code refers to a request for assistance with a deceased person.

Are police codes the same in every region?

No, police codes can vary by region, and some areas may use different codes for the same situations.

How do police codes improve communication?

Police codes improve communication by allowing officers to convey critical information quickly and efficiently over radio channels.
